Monograph . - Kherson: Grin D . C. , 2011. — 470 s. The monograph is devoted to the consideration of methods of studying forest fires, the use of which allows to more effectively carry out activities for the prevention of forest fires, their elimination and prevention of consequences. The book provides an overview of existing methods for modeling forest fire behavior, as well as forest fire hazard assessment. Some of the most well-known fire risk assessment systems are described in detail: American and Canadian. The authors proposed a simulation model of fire based on the chemical laws of combustion and formal logical apparatus. The book also discusses the approach to building a forest fire model using artificial neural networks that allow processing large sets of features of a different nature, which are characterized by forest fires. Special attention is paid to the use of modern information technologies in forest fire management. The book proposes the architecture of a geo-informational decision support system to combat forest fires. Integration of geoinformation and Internet technologies for creation of web-oriented geoinformation system of forestry is also considered.
